aboutsummaryrefslogtreecommitdiffstats
path: root/assets/less/lib/mixins.less
diff options
context:
space:
mode:
Diffstat (limited to 'assets/less/lib/mixins.less')
-rw-r--r--assets/less/lib/mixins.less27
1 files changed, 27 insertions, 0 deletions
diff --git a/assets/less/lib/mixins.less b/assets/less/lib/mixins.less
new file mode 100644
index 00000000..c6412a55
--- /dev/null
+++ b/assets/less/lib/mixins.less
@@ -0,0 +1,27 @@
+// ==========================================================================
+// Mixins
+// ==========================================================================
+
+// Contain floats: nicolasgallagher.com/micro-clearfix-hack/
+.clearfix() {
+ zoom: 1;
+ &:before,
+ &:after { content: ""; display: table; }
+ &:after { clear: both; }
+}
+
+// Webkit-style focus
+.tab-focus() {
+ // Default
+ outline: thin dotted @gray-dark;
+ // Webkit
+ //outline: 5px auto -webkit-focus-ring-color;
+ outline-offset: 1px;
+}
+
+// Use rems for font sizing
+.font-size(@font-size: 16){
+ @rem: (@font-size / 10);
+ font-size: @font-size * 1px;
+ font-size: ~"@{rem}rem";
+} \ No newline at end of file